Impact-resistant PC/ABS

Updated: 2026-08-03

Overview

Impact-resistant PC/ABS is an engineered thermoplastic alloy that synergizes the superior mechanical strength of polycarbonate (PC) with the processability and cost efficiency of acrylonitrile butadiene styrene (ABS). Developed to address the limitations of pure PC (brittleness at low temperatures) and ABS (lower heat resistance), this blend is a staple in industries demanding durability and design flexibility. The material is typically produced via twin-screw extrusion, ensuring homogeneous dispersion of ABS domains within the PC matrix. Grades are tailored through additives like impact modifiers, UV stabilizers, or halogen-free flame retardants to meet specific industry standards such as automotive OEM specifications or UL certifications.

Physical and Chemical Properties

PC/ABS exhibits a unique balance of properties: tensile strength ranges from 45–60 MPa, while notched Izod impact resistance typically exceeds 500 J/m (ASTM D256), making it 5–10x tougher than standard ABS. Its heat deflection temperature (HDT) under load (1.82 MPa) is 90–110°C, outperforming ABS by ~30°C. Chemically, the blend resists dilute acids, alkalis, and aliphatic hydrocarbons but may stress-crack in contact with ketones or esters. UV-stabilized grades retain 80% of mechanical properties after 1,000 hours of QUV exposure. Rheological properties allow injection molding at 230–270°C with low warpage, suitable for thin-walled components.

Main Applications

In automotive engineering, PC/ABS is the material of choice for dashboard components, door handles, and pillar trims due to its passenger safety compliance (e.g., low smoke emission) and Class A surface finish capability. Electronics manufacturers utilize flame-retardant grades (UL94 V-0) for laptop housings and power adapters. The medical sector employs gamma-ray-sterilizable grades for equipment housings, while consumer goods leverage its scratch resistance for vacuum cleaner parts and appliance controls. Emerging applications include 5G antenna housings, where its RF transparency and weatherability are advantageous.

Safety and Storage

While PC/ABS pellets are stable at room temperature, prolonged exposure to humidity (>0.1% moisture content) can cause hydrolysis during processing, leading to degraded mechanical properties. Industrial users should store materials in sealed containers with desiccants and pre-dry at 80–100°C for 2–4 hours before molding. Thermal degradation above 300°C releases trace amounts of styrene and bisphenol A. Facilities must install fume extraction systems and enforce OSHA-compliant ventilation. Spills of pelletized material require no special protocols beyond standard plastic waste disposal, but powdered material demands respiratory protection during cleanup.

B2B Procurement Guide

Industrial buyers should prioritize suppliers with ISO 9001-certified compounding facilities and batch traceability. Key specifications to request include melt flow index (MFI) at 250°C/5 kg (typically 10–30 g/10min), multi-axial impact test data (ASTM D3763), and RoHS/REACH compliance documentation. For cost optimization, consider regional pricing variations: Asian-sourced PC/ABS often offers 10–15% savings but may lack OEM approvals. Just-in-time procurement is advisable due to price volatility in benzene and propylene feedstocks. Technical support for mold flow analysis and gate design should be included in premium supplier contracts.
